The SA8026DH is a high-performance, low-power frequency synthesizer designed by NXP Semiconductors. It is engineered to meet the rigorous demands of modern wireless communication systems, providing a versatile solution for a wide range of applications, including mobile phones, wireless LANs, and other RF systems.
Key Features
- High Frequency Range: The SA8026DH operates at a wide frequency range, making it suitable for various communication standards.
- Low Phase Noise: It offers low phase noise performance, which is critical for maintaining signal integrity in communication systems.
- Programmable Divider: The device includes a programmable divider that allows for fine-tuning of the output frequency, providing flexibility in system design.
- Voltage Controlled Oscillator (VCO): The integrated VCO simplifies the design process by reducing the number of external components required.
- Power Saving Mode: The SA8026DH features a power-saving mode that reduces power consumption when the device is not in active use, extending battery life in portable applications.
Applications
The SA8026DH is ideal for a variety of applications where stable and precise frequency generation is essential. Its adaptability makes it a go-to component for:
- Mobile and cordless phones
- Wireless LAN (WLAN) devices
- Personal communication services (PCS)
- Global system for mobile communications (GSM)
- General RF transceivers
